The present invention relates to pyrophoric lighters in which a flint and abradant wheel are used to produce a spark to ignite fuel which is stored in the casing of the lighter, more particularly to a pyrophoric lighter of the aforesaid type including a removable magazine for storing spare flints.
The present application is a continuation-in-part of my copending application Serial No. 310,788, filed September 22, 1952 which matured into Patent No. 2,737,796 on March 13, 1956.
It is an object of the present invention to provide a member movably accommodating a magazine element for storing spare fiints, the member being adapted to be attached to a conventional pyrophoric lighter and to be operated when attached to the lighter without necessitating any changes in the structure of the lighter.
It is a further object of the present invention to provide a conventional lighter having a threaded filler plug for closing the fuel magazine with a member for storing spare flints, the member including a threaded portion which fits into the threaded hole for the filler plug so that the filler plug can be replaced by the said threaded portion, the member having a portion adapted. to receive a flint storing element and to serve as a handle when screwing the threaded portion into or unscrewing the threaded portion from the filler plug hole. 7
Another object of the invention resides in the provision of a member for storing spare flints which member can be attached to a conventional pyrophoric lighter having a fuel container and a threaded filler hole in the bottom of the container, a threaded sleeve being inserted in the aforesaid member which sleeve fits into the filler plug hole and means being provided to close the bore in the sleeve.

Referring more particularly to Figs. l to 4 of the drawing, numeral 2 designates the casing of a conventional llgnter of which only the lower part is shown. A hollow member 1 having an outside configuration conforming with that of the casing 2 is attached to the bottom of the latter. A flint magazine element 3 is slldably inserted in the member 1. The element 3 has a plurality of cavities 4 for individually receiving a spare flint 5.
The member 1 containing the flint magazine element is secured to the casing 2 by means of a threaded plug 6 which is rigidly connected with the top of the member 1, preferably at the'center of the top surface. The plug 6 fits into a threaded bore 7 in the bottom of the casing 2, replacing the conventional tiller plug. lne member 1 can serve as a handle for turning the plug 6 when removal of the latter is desired for filling fuel into the casing 2.
For replacing a worn Him the member 1 need be swung onlyto the extent that the conventional plug is retaining a spring 8 in a tube 9 can be removed for pulling the spring 8 out of the tube 9. The spring 8, when in position inside the tube 9 presses a flint in the conventional manner against an abradant wheel (not shown by pulling the drawerlike magazine element 3 out of the ,memoer 1 a spare flint 5 can be taken from one of the cavities 4 and inserted in the tube 9. '1 nereupon tne element a is pushed back all the way into the member 1, the spring 8 is inserted into the tube 9, and the plug o is screwed m place. The member I can now be swung back into its normal position.
'Since normal position of the member 1 relatively to the casing 2 will not always coincide with the position in which the plug 6 tightly closes the opening 7, the plug 6 is preferably so constructed that the relative angular position of the threaded portion of the plug and of the member 1 can be changed. For this reason the plug 6 preferably consists of three parts: a part 11 permanently attached to the top surface of the member 1 and having a splined cylindrical surface portion 11' fitting into a splined interior surface of an externally threaded sleeve iii. The part 11 is secured in the sleeve 10 by means of a screw 12. Removal of the latter affords pulling of the sleeve it! from the part 11 and relative rotation of the sleeve 16 and of the part 11 so that upon reassembly of the plug 6 the thread on the outside of the sleeve 10 is in a diiferent position with respect to the part 11 and the member 1.
In the modification illustrated in Figs. 5 to 9 a member 13 is removably attached to the bottom of the casing 14 of a conventional lighter of which only the lower portion of the casing containing the fuel is shown. One end of the member 13 is provided with a semicylindrical recess 16 into which a cylindrical flint magazine 15 is rotatably fitted, the member 15 rotating on a pin 17 and having a knurled surface portion 15 facilitating manual rotation of the member 15. The latter is provided with a plurality of bores 18 arranged on a circle around the pin 17, the bores 18 being parallel to the pin 17 and adapted to individually receive a spare The'cylindrical magazine 15 and the pin 17 are held in the cavity or recess 16 by means of a plate 30 secured ,to the bottom of the member 13 by means of screws lighter casing designed to receive the conventional filler plug which has been removed. The lowerpart ofthe sleeve 20 extends through a bore .22 in the member 13 and.has a.collar 21 abutting .againsta shoulder inthe bore "22. Asshown in 'Fig. '8 the 'sleeve20 has a bore whose lower part'24 is adaptedto receive a s itabletool for tightening the threaded sleeve'in the. threadedibore 23. The bore 22 is closed by a' threaded plugl'25 serving as afiller plug for the'fuel reservoir in'tlie lighter casing 14. I
For replacing a worn him a plug"27 which is screwed into the plate 30 is removed so that a conventional spring 26 which extendsthrou'gh a tube, 28 in the lighter casing 14 and through one of the bores 18 inthe mag"zine memberTS can be removed through ahole in the member 30 which hole is in line withlthe tube v28 and which is' closed by 'the closure 27. 'The spring'26 presses a flint against an abradant wheel '(not shown) in the conventional manner. The magazine element'lS can now be rotated to align a borefi18 containing a spare .fiint19 with the tube 28 for pushing a new Ifiint thereinto. Thereupon the spring26 and the plug 27 are reinserted.
Whena'll spare'flints in the member'lS are used up the screws 29 and the plate 30are removed,-exposing the lower surface of the member'15'so" that'a newlsupply of flints can beinserted inlthe bores'18'of'the maga zine member 15.

When a new flint is neededa plug 47 is removed from the bottom plate-and a conventional spring- 45. extending through one of the tubes 43.and"through a tube .46 in the lighter casing is removed. The spring 45 presses a fiint against an abradant wheel (notshown) in the conventional manner. The belt .44'can .;now be moved until a tube containing aznew .flint is inlline with'the tube 46 and the new fiint.can be pushed thereinto. Thereupon the spring 45. is inserted into the tube 46 and the plug 47 is screwed into theplate 39. When the supply of spare fiints isjexhausted'thexscrews 481securing the lower plate 39 to the member 31 and the plate 39 are removed so that all tubes 43 are 'accessibleand new flints can be inserted inthe'tubes.
